NFL: Minnesota 29, Oakland 22

|
|
 
  
Published: Nov. 18, 2007 at 5:47 PM

MINNEAPOLIS, Nov. 18 (UPI) -- Chester Taylor had three touchdowns and 164 yards on 22 carries Sunday as the Minnesota Vikings topped the Oakland Raiders 29-22.

Tarvaris Jackson completed 17 of 22 passes for 171 yards and one interception for the Vikings (4-6). Bobby Wade also ran for 45 yards on five catches for Minnesota.

Former Minnesota quarterback Daunte Culpepper faced off against the Vikings for the first time as an opponent, completing 23 of 39 passes for 344 yards, one touchdown and one interception for the Raiders.

Sebastian Janikowski completed five field goals.

Ronald Curry also had four catches for 120 yards for Oakland (2-8) who have lost six games straight.
